Tailored, a new direct-to-consumer, personalized dog food brand, has partnered with TerraCycle® to make the packaging for their pet food nationally recyclable throughout the United States. As an added incentive, for every shipment of Tailored packaging waste sent to TerraCycle, collectors earn points that can be donated to a non-profit, school or charitable organization of their choice.

Through the Tailored Recycling Program, consumers can now send in their empty Tailored pet food packaging to be recycled for free. Participation is easy: sign up on the TerraCycle program page https://www.terracycle.com/en-US/brigades/tailored-pet-nutrition and mail in the packaging using a prepaid shipping label. Once collected, the packaging is cleaned and melted into hard plastic that can be remolded to make new recycled products.
